Transaction 84f50ad9130345dd6a182e2c321928886184a9be60bfb9e6bc183ab2a6907744
1 Input
1 Output
-
84f50ad9130345dd6a182e2c321928886184a9be60bfb9e6bc183ab2a6907744:0
- value
- 8886557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75bff13ee4b2c91d52d25a3e12cecc2b8671f3fd OP_EQUAL
- address
- 3CRcvNqVRzitrmyeEwjkJif4sRQRNmeqBM